Extreme vibration at certain RPM’s after transmission work

So a little over a month ago I brought my FRS into a shop to have my throw out bearing replaced after I noticed it started making weird noises and doing all the other telltale signs of a bad throw out bearing. When they pulled it apart they basically explained to me that the transmission had grenaded. Everything appeared to be burnt, warped, scratched, etc. they replaced numerous components but also resurfaced many, such as the flywheel. After about a month, I finally got my car back and noticed that it had a much rougher idle than before and around 3k rpm, the car vibrates like crazy, to the point where almost every part of my car now has a rattle. From my research this is due to the flywheel being resurfaced incorrectly. I plan on reaching back out to the shop and am trying to get the best guess as to what could be going on, so any information you guys could share would be extremely helpful. Thanks in advance.
